About the Role

As a People Ops Specialist at Firstbase, you will play a pivotal role in shaping the employee experience and strengthening our company culture in a remote-first, global environment. You will not only execute traditional HR functions like payroll, onboarding, and benefits administration, but also drive process improvements, implement efficiencies, and leverage the right tools to optimize the way we work, with AI and automation as an added bonus.

We’re looking for a strategic thinker who thrives on building and refining processes while ensuring a seamless and engaging employee experience. If you're passionate about scaling People Ops with efficiency, data, and technology, this is your opportunity to make a lasting impact in a fast-growing company.

Here’s how you’ll make an impact:

  • Define, implement, and document People Ops processes, ensuring they are scalable, efficient, and aligned with business goals.

  • Identify opportunities for process improvement, owning initiatives that drive impact at scale.

  • Own the Employee Onboarding Program from end to end, ensuring new hires have an exceptional experience from day one.

  • Optimize and execute payroll with accuracy, validating variable data (benefits, expenses, promotions, salary raises, etc).

  • Leverage the right tools and platforms to streamline People Ops efficiency and enhance the employee experience, with a focus on AI and automation.

  • Harness metrics and analytics to guide strategies and assess the impact of HR initiatives.

  • Be a guardian of internal policies, ensuring compliance and clarity across the organization.

  • Ensure that all HR practices comply with local, state, and federal regulations, as well as company policies.

  • Assist in the organization of team events such as all-hands meetings and company retreats.

  • Act as a welcoming and responsive point of contact for employee inquiries.

Perks & Benefits
  • Competitive Salary & Equity: We pay top-tier because you deserve it, plus equity so you can share in the success of the future we’re building together.

  • Flexible Work Setup: We offer the freedom to work remotely, embracing diverse work styles, while NYC-based team members can opt for a hybrid setup, spending some days in the office to foster collaboration.

  • 21 Days of PTO & Other Time Off Benefits: Take the opportunity to rest and recharge. No questions asked — it’s time to disconnect and come back stronger. Plus, you’ll receive 5 sick days, your birthday off, unlimited out-of-office days, and national holidays (US or Brazil).

  • Build Your Ideal Work Setup: We provide a renewable stipend every two years to create your perfect home office. It’s about giving you the tools to do your best work.

  • Comprehensive Health Benefits: Comprehensive health insurance reimbursement for US and international employees. No matter where you are, you’re covered.

  • Learning & Development: We invest in your growth. Use your stipend to continue expanding your skills and advancing your career.

  • Annual Anniversary Gift: Receive a special gift each year to celebrate your journey with Firstbase as a thank you for your dedication!

  • Parental Leave: We stand by you during life's most important moments. You’re entitled to 4 weeks of paid Parental Leave, covering maternity, paternity, and adoption.

  • Performance-Driven Annual Bonuses: Expect a bonus that reflects your hard work — usually about 10% of your OTE. From your second year, a 20% annual multiplier boosts this, rewarding your consistent performance.

  • Vacation Bonus: After 3 years at Firstbase, you'll receive a generous vacation bonus to take that dream trip. It’s our way of saying "thanks" for your commitment — we’re here for the long haul, and we want you to enjoy the ride. 🌍✈️
